Death of a Prince: The Tragedy of William of Gloucester
Channel 5, 9pm
The death of the late Queen’s cousin, aged 30 and ninth in line to the throne, filled the headlines in 1972 but is now largely forgotten. Archive and talking heads recapture how the plane the prince was piloting hit a tree and burst into flames at an airshow near Wolverhampton.
